๐ Ramallah is located in the central West Bank and is known as the de facto administrative capital of the State of Palestine.
๐ The name 'Ramallah' means 'the height of God'.
๐ฐ Ramallah has a long history, with habitation dating back to ancient times.
๐๏ธ The city is a mix of modern life and traditional culture, making it vibrant and lively.
๐ Ramallah is about 10 kilometers north of Jerusalem and sits at an altitude of about 880 meters.
๐จ Ramallah is known for being a cultural hub, with many theaters, galleries, and festivals.
๐๏ธ The economy of Ramallah is diverse, with lively markets and shops supporting local artisans and technology companies.
๐ซ Education is important in Ramallah, which is home to several universities, including Birzeit University.
๐ป Agriculture, especially olive farming, plays a role in Ramallah's economy.
๐บ Ramallah has historical landmarks like the Yasser Arafat Tomb and ancient churches reflecting its rich past.
